Energy, Biotechnology and Agribusiness Veterans Form SG Biofuels to Develop Jatropha as Low-Cost, Sustainable Oil
Following three years of research, a team of energy, biotechnology and agribusiness veterans announced the formation of SG Biofuels, a San Diego, CA-based plant oil company specializing in the development of Jatropha as a low-cost, sustainably produced source of oil. READ MORE
